New York City Emergency Management (NYCEM) helps New Yorkers before, during, and after emergencies through preparedness, education, and response. NYCEM is responsible for coordinating citywide emergency planning and response for all types and scales of emergencies. We are staffed by more than 200 dedicated professionals with diverse backgrounds and areas of expertise, including individuals assigned from other City agencies.

The Office of the Chief Counsel provides legal advice to the agency regarding critical, strategic, legal and policy issues facing the agency, engages in transactional work in support of the NYCEM mission and coordinates with the NYC Law Department, Office of the Counsel to the Mayor, and other local, state and federal counsels regarding various legal issues ranging from emergency events to litigation which impact the agency.

The Office of Chief Counsel is comprised of the Legal Affairs Unit, Disability, Access, and Functional Needs (DAFN) Legal Unit, and the Records Management Unit.

The Legal Affairs unit within the Office of the Chief Counsel provides legal advice to NYCEM executives and staff regarding critical, strategic, legal and policy issues facing the agency which impact the public, engages in transactional work in support of the NYCEM mission and coordinates with the NYC Law Department, Office of the Counsel to the Mayor and City Hall, and other local, state and federal counsels regarding various legal issues ranging from emergency events to litigation which impact the agency.

We are seeking a skilled and forward-thinking Attorney with expertise in privacy law, data protection, and information technology to join our dynamic legal team. Reporting to the Deputy Chief Counsel, this role provides strategic legal guidance at the intersection of law and technology. The selected candidate will provide Agency units and bureaus with support and legal advice with respect to agency initiatives, policies and programs.

Reporting directly to the Deputy Chief Counsel, with wide latitude for independent judgment and un-reviewed action, areas of responsibility will include:

AGENCY ATTORNEY - 30087

Key Responsibilities
  • Attend meetings, conferences, and workshops as required or needed.
  • Supervise legal and administrative staff to ensure quality, completeness, and compliance with agency policies and standards.
  • Provide timely, accurate legal advice on compliance, contracting, procurement, and related matters.
  • Advise on global, federal, and state privacy regulations (e.g., GDPR, CCPA, HIPAA).
  • Draft, review, and negotiate technology, SaaS, data processing, and other complex IT agreements.
  • Collaborate with IT/MIS, security, and agency units to implement privacy-by-design practices.
  • Monitor emerging privacy laws, cybersecurity regulations, and industry best practices.
  • Support incident response and data breach investigations.
  • Develop and review processes to ensure compliance with local laws, rules, and codes.
  • Coordinate with internal teams and external agencies on legal issues, emergency events, and litigation.
  • Promote interagency cooperation and maintain timely, accurate correspondence.
  • Prepare and review legal documents, research applicable laws, and draft explanatory materials for agency and public use.
  • Lead special projects and perform administrative duties as directed.
  • Serve as acting supervisor during temporary absences.
PLEASE NOTE THE FOLLOWING
  • The selected candidate will be assigned to an on‑call Emergency Operations Center (EOC) team and will be expected to work non‑business hours during some emergencies. These non‑business hours include nights, weekends, holidays, and extended week hours outside of a 9 AM‑5 PM schedule. The selected candidate will also participate in trainings to build skills and competencies in emergency response; will participate in drills and exercises associated with the on‑call EOC team;

    and may volunteer to assist with Ready NY emergency preparedness presentations to external groups. EOC teams are on call for three weeks at a time, with six weeks off in between.
